&lt;p&gt;We’re halfway through the tournament now, Rog and Rafa are still there and we are looking good-ish for another repeat finale, but where I was confident in my Nadal bet (since traded out and reduced vastly) I’m now not so sure he has what it takes.  Against Gulbis he was pressured, even against Kiefer he looked rather impotent in the first set.  Take a look where he’s returning serve now, he’s resorted to standing in the locker room again, if not outside the stadium to return serves, this gives a decent server time to get into net on this surface.  Worryingly too there were signs of his shots dropping shorter v Kiefer, something he has suffered with on the faster surfaces.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;I’m still confident he can sort this out, and perhaps he is making some attempt to not peak too early, to come out in the final with a new set of tactics to what he has used the rest of the tournament.  The surface dfinitely suits him, it’s still slow, it’s bouncing ever higher the longer the tournament goes on and his game has improved massively in the last 3 years… he can attack with the best of them now.  Step up Rafa, lets see some of that Queens form.&lt;/p&gt;</description><link>http://mini.punt.com/post/40333897</link><guid>http://mini.punt.com/post/40333897</guid><pubDate>Sun, 29 Jun 2008 17:48:00 -0400</pubDate><category>rafael nadal</category><category>wimbledon</category></item><item><title>Wimbledon Day 5 Matches</title><description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;img src="http://puntdotcom.typepad.com/todays_in_play_27th_june.png" alt="27th June In Play Tennis Matches"/&gt;&lt;/p&gt;</description><link>http://mini.punt.com/post/40026407</link><guid>http://mini.punt.com/post/40026407</guid><pubDate>Fri, 27 Jun 2008 04:00:20 -0400</pubDate><category>betfair</category><category>todays in play matches</category><category>27th june</category><category>wimbledon betting</category></item><item><title>TickSize - A New Blog</title><description>&lt;a href="http://ticksize.blogspot.com/"&gt;TickSize - A New Blog&lt;/a&gt;: &lt;p&gt;…hoping this one’s gonna be a good read.&lt;/p&gt;</description><link>http://mini.punt.com/post/39893607</link><guid>http://mini.punt.com/post/39893607</guid><pubDate>Thu, 26 Jun 2008 04:25:51 -0400</pubDate></item><item><title>25th June Wimbledon Day 3 Matches</title><description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;img src="http://puntdotcom.typepad.com/todays_in_play_25th_june.png" alt="25th June In Play Tennis Matches"/&gt;&lt;/p&gt;</description><link>http://mini.punt.com/post/39756547</link><guid>http://mini.punt.com/post/39756547</guid><pubDate>Wed, 25 Jun 2008 04:29:43 -0400</pubDate><category>todays in play matches</category><category>betfair</category><category>tennis</category><category>wimbledon</category></item><item><title>24th June Wimbledon Day 2 Matches</title><description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;img src="http://puntdotcom.typepad.com/todays_in_play_24th_june.png" alt="24th June In Play Tennis Matches"/&gt;&lt;/p&gt;</description><link>http://mini.punt.com/post/39622042</link><guid>http://mini.punt.com/post/39622042</guid><pubDate>Tue, 24 Jun 2008 04:48:57 -0400</pubDate><category>todays in play matches</category><category>betfair</category><category>tennis</category><category>wimbledon</category></item></channel></rss>
